함수만들기
~cpp
#include <iostream>
using namespace std;
bool team684(int people,int gun,int boat){
if((people+gun)*boat>=200)
return true;
else
return false;
}
void main() {
if(team684(10,30,10))
cout << "Complete";
else
cout << "fault";
cout << endl;
}
----
주사위
~cpp
#include <iostream>
#include <time.h>
using namespace std;
int ju42(){
srand(time(NULL));
return (rand()%6+1);
}
int main(){
cout << ju42() << endl;
return 0;
}
----
백설공주
~cpp
#include <iostream>
#include <time.h>
using namespace std;
void nan1();
void nan2();
void nan3();
void nan4();
void nan5();
void nan6();
void nan7();
void pr100();
int main(){
int c;
srand(time(NULL));
c=rand()%7+1;
switch(c){
case 1: nan1(); break;
case 2: nan2(); break;
case 3: nan3(); break;
case 4: nan4(); break;
case 5: nan5(); break;
case 6: nan6(); break;
case 7: nan7(); break;
default: pr100; break;
}
nan4();
return 0;
}
void nan1(){
cout << "첫째 난장이가 둘째를 부른다" << endl;
nan2();
}
void nan2(){
cout << "둘째 난장이가 셋째를 부른다" << endl;
nan3();
}
void nan3(){
cout << "셋째 난장이가 넷째를 부른다" << endl;
nan4();
}
void nan4(){
cout << "넷째 난장이가 다섯째를 부른다" << endl;
nan5();
}
void nan5(){
cout << "다섯째 난장이가 여섯째를 부른다" << endl;
nan6();
}
void nan6(){
cout << "여섯째 난장이가 일곱째를 부른다" << endl;
nan7();
}
void nan7(){
cout << "일곱째 난장이가 백설공주를 부른다" << endl;
pr100();
}
void pr100(){
cout << "백설공주" << endl;
}